Ideal Self
The person one would like to be.
Looking-Glass Self
The self that people think other people see them as.

The ideal self refers to how individuals would like to be, representing their goals and aspirations, while the looking-glass self is a concept that describes how individuals think they appear to others, influenced by the perceived judgments of others.
